> Vulnerability in Comcast Webmail Manager allows arbitrary java and activex code 
> execution
> Systems: Comcast Webmail email system. www.comcast.net
> Vulnerable: X-Mailer: AT&T Message Center Version 1 (Mar 22 2004)
> Not Vulnerable: Unknown
> Severity: Serious / Low (Fixed now)
> Category: Arbitrary Execution of Code of Hackers Choice
> Classification: Input Validation Error
> BugTraq-ID: TBA
> CVE-Number: TBA
> Remote Exploit: yes
> Local Exploit: no
> Vendor URL: www.comcast.net
> Author: Michael S. Scheidell, SECNAP Network Security
> Original Release date: April 7, 2004
> Notifications: Comcast notified April 7, 2004
> Public Release date: July 22, 2004

> Problem: There was a potential for hackers to use this vulnerability to specially 
> craft emails that will run random code of their choice on users' computers - 
> including remote Trojans, irc zombies, spyware, malware, and remote key loggers. 
> This program would run inside the corporate network, behind the firewall and access 
> anything the infected user has access to.
>
> The Comcast Webmail did not run the html email in the 'security zone' as does 
> Microsoft(tm) Outlook, but passed anything that looks like HTML to be executed 
> unrestricted directly to the default Browser (usually IE). Linux/or Unix users with 
> Netscape may have the javascript, page redirection and popup email run, however, the 
> activeX component will not run.
>
> Comcast users have the option of using Comcast Webmail or Outlook Express.  Because 
> of the inability to disable html/java/or active-x in Comcast Webmail, those using 
> Webmail had an increased chance of their computers' becoming infected in the event 
> of a potential hacker either a) referencing active-x controls or b) including 
> javascript within an HTML e-mail message.
>
> The above has been tested on a Windows(tm) 2000 system with service pack 4, all 
> Internet Explorer patches and default (factory) Internet zone security settings. 
> Also tested were two Windows XP(tm) systems with service pack 1 and all patches as 
> well as Netscape 7.1 on Linux.

> The security community first became aware of the potential for this kind of threat 
> about two years ago.  Software companies that produce Web-based email, blog or input 
> system must check for arbitrary java and html code.  Note:  the original Web Mail 
> system was written by AT&T and was inherited by Comcast during their purchase of 
> AT&T's broadband business.
>
> Exploit: No exploit is necessary, as there are already examples in viruses and 
> trojans that were designed to attack Microsoft Outlook and Outlook Express.
>
> Microsoft fixed these by patching both readers and allowing the user to set the 
> security zone for reading HTML email in the 'insecure' settings.

> Vendor Response: April 7, 2004. A Comcast representative called our office 
> immediately.  Comcast worked quickly on fixing this bug and rolling it out to their 
> servers, with a solution in place by April 13, 2004.  Release of this notification 
> was held back waiting for Comcast to decide how and when to self-release.
>
> Solution:
> Comcast is now filtering out various forms of scripting.
